CRèME FRAîCHE PANNA COTTA WITH STRAWBERRIES

The stated purpose of my junior year abroad was to study at the famous London School of Economics, but the first thing I did when I got to England was land a part-time job at the Roux brothers' (also famous) restaurant, Le Mazarin. Of all the challenges of living abroad, I never thought I'd have a problem finding something decent to eat. Boy, was I wrong. While the food we served guests at Le Mazarin was topnotch, staff meals were a different story. Stripped chicken carcasses, limp vegetable trimmings, and, if we were lucky, a box of just-add-water mashed-potato flakes were the components of just about every meal. The rest of London wasn't offering many great options either at that time. Fish and chips and heavy pub fare dominated the food scene in the late eighties, before Britain's culinary renaissance. The one thing I found worth eating (and could afford on the £10 a week my job paid) was scones with clotted cream and strawberries. And that's exactly what I ate, for 6 straight months. After so many meals of strawberries and cream, it's a wonder that I still love that combination. Panna cotta ("cooked cream"), a silken, eggless Italian custard, is an easy-to-make complement to perfectly ripe berries. I've added crème fraîche to the traditional recipe to balance the strawberries' sweetness with some tang. You can make the panna cotta in individual ramekins and unmold them just before serving or make it in a large gratin dish and spoon it out at the table family-style.

Steps:

  • Place the milk in a large bowl, sprinkle the gelatin over it, and stir to combine.
  • In a medium saucepan, bring the cream and 5 tablespoons sugar to a boil. Lightly oil eight 4-ounce ramekins or custard cups (or a large gratin dish if serving family-style).
  • When the cream mixture comes to a boil, turn off the heat and let it sit a few minutes.
  • Slowly whisk the cream into the gelatin, and then whisk in the crème fraîche.
  • Strain the mixture, and pour it into the prepared molds.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 3 hours.
  • Ten minutes before serving, slice the strawberries, and toss them with a tablespoon or so of sugar, to taste.
  • Run a hot knife around the edges of the panna cotta and invert it onto a large chilled platter. Surround the custard with the strawberries and their juice.

1/2 cup cold whole milk
Heaping 3 1/2 teaspoons unflavored gelatin, or 1/4-ounce package
3 cups heavy cream
6 tablespoons granulated sugar
Vegetable oil, for molds
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ons crème fraîche
1 1/2 pints fresh strawberries

CREME FRAICHE PANNA COTTA JUBILEE STYLE

Provided by Guy Fieri

Categories     dessert

Time 3h40m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12



Creme Fraiche Panna Cotta Jubilee Style image

Steps:

  • Place the cream, milk and sugar in a medium saucepan and b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Split and scrape the vanilla seeds from the bean. Add both the seeds and the pod to the milk.
  • Once the milk mixture begins to simmer, shut off the heat and whisk in the creme fraiche. Strain the mixture and return to the pot. Add the gelatin and stir until dissolved.
  • Pour the mixture into 8 (1 cup) ramekins and set aside to come to room temperature. Cover and place in the refrigerator to firm up for at least 3 hours, but it is best to let sit overnight.
  • To make the sauce, combine the cherries and their juices, the cherry brandy, and the port in a medium saucepan with low sides, over medium heat. When mixture is hot, remove the pan from the heat and ignite with a long kitchen match. Once the flame subsides, return the pan to medium heat.
  • Add the sugar, cinnamon, and the lemon zest and stir until the sugar has dissolved and the mixture starts to thicken, about 3 more minutes. Let the mixture cool to room temperature and serve with the Panna Cotta.

3 cups heavy cream
3 cups whole milk
1 cup granulated sugar
1 vanilla bean
2 cups creme fraiche
2 tablespoons plus 1/4 teaspoon powdered gelatin
2 pounds frozen cherries, pitted and thawed
1/2 cup cherry brandy (recommended: Kirsch)
1/3 cup ruby port
3 tablespoons confectioners' s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 lemon, zested, cut into strips

CRèME FRAîCHE PANNA COTTA - SUGARHERO
Web Sep 28, 2013 1 1/2 cups heavy cream 2/3 cup granulated sugar 8 oz crème fraîche, can substitute full-fat sour cream 2 tsp vanilla bean …
From sugarhero.com
5/5 (1)
Total Time 2 hrs 15 mins
Servings 6
Calories 375 per serving
  • Whisk together the gelatin and the water in a small bowl. Set it aside to let the gelatin absorb the water, for about 5 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, combine the heavy cream and the sugar in a medium saucepan. Whisk together, and place over medium heat until the cream is hot and the sugar is dissolved, but do not allow the cream to boil. Remove the pan from the heat.
  • Microwave the bowl of gelatin for 15 seconds, until it is liquefied. Whisk the gelatin into the cream, then add the crème fraîche, vanilla bean paste, and salt. Whisk until everything is smooth.
  • Pour the panna cotta into six 1/2-cup serving bowls. Refrigerate them until chilled and set, at least 2 hours. (Panna cottas can be made several days in advance and kept in the refrigerator. If making in advance, cover the bowls loosely with cling wrap.) Garnish with a drizzle of balsamic glaze, a few sliced strawberries, and a sprinkle of fresh basil.
